Product details
Sailor Moon Dog Tag Necklace featuring Sailor Moon from the anime and manga series.
Size: 2 x 1 Inches
SKU: NC80562
UPC: 699858805624
Brand: Great Eastern
Product type: Necklace
Sailor Moon Dog Tag Necklace featuring Sailor Moon from the anime and manga series.
Size: 2 x 1 Inches